Gregory Rodrigues Outpoints Roman Kopylov by Unanimous Decision at UFC 322
Early pressure with well-timed level changes produced a scorecard sweep at Madison Square Garden.
Overview
- Judges scored the bout 30–27, 30–27 and 29–28 for Rodrigues.
- Rodrigues mixed heavy right hands with takedown threats, including a near heel hook in round two.
- Kopylov rallied in the final frame, wobbling Rodrigues, yet could not overturn the early deficit.
- The three-round middleweight contest took place on the UFC 322 undercard in New York.
- The victory marked Rodrigues’ 18th career win, and he later called for Israel Adesanya or Robert Whittaker while expressing interest in a five-round main event.
